Charleston style home in small quiet subdivision on the Eastside of Greenville. The largest home in the neighborhood (over 3300 square feet) features a 2 Car Garage, 3 or 4 Bedrooms 2 1/2 Baths, Dining Room, Great Room, Bonus Room plus another large room without closet...could be the 4th Bedroom and there's also a large loft area (20x10). The Kitchen has wonderful counter space, black appliances, an eating bar, large pantry and a desk area. The main level Master Bedroom features a full Bath with Dual Sinks, Garden Tub and separate Shower. Hardwood Floors are on the entire main level. The upstairs has a number of possibilities! 2 Bedrooms, a Jack & Jill Bath, Bonus Room and a large Loft. The additional room without a closet can be used as a 4th Bedroom/Flex space--use your imagination! Don't forget the walk-in attic storage off the bonus room. There is also an accessible 2nd floor porch and side covered deck for grilling. All appliances to remain including refrigerator, except washer and dryer(negotiable). This home also includes a 1 year Home Warranty!
